Wimbledon 2005, Day 7
Like a cat stalking her prey, Maria Sharapova lay in wait for Nathalie Dechy's moment of distraction at Wimbledon on Monday before pouncing to win 6-4, 6-2.
Sharapova has not lost on grass for two years. She has won the Birmingham warm-up tournament twice and beaten title holder Serena Williams at Wimbledon last year in a memorable final for her first grand slam victory at only 17 years old.
"Once you are in the second week mentally and physically you have to be much tougher," Sharapova said. "But I'm really excited ... I love being out there. I love competing especially here."
